    Default VP Nismodore Sleeper project

    FOR SALE!!!!!
    SLEEPER


    1992 VP exec, was 3.8 auto
    12 months rego

    Engine:rb20det
    Box: manual conversion to r32 skyline 5speed
    Diff: lsd 4:11 ratio
    Fuel: dual pumps, intank and surge tank/ external bosch 038
    Exhaust: 3.5 inch dump pipe, high flow cat and 3 inch system
    Suspension: harder shockies, harder springs, lower by an inch
    Brakes:front- vt twin spots on full floating conversion with slotted oversized rotors, rears- slottled with vs calipers

    Hydraulic handbrake fitted

    Engineered for, engine and box, brakes, intercooler, steering wheel, not hydraulic handbrake


    Comes with 2 R32 skyline seats, drivers one is fitted but passengers one isnt
    2 spare mags with tyres and 2 spare stockies
